Output d80b745b8d1b9e8cc7d24a35981b99315b823628974ed94caec85d394231aca5:1

value
72500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7153a4cd073575623f2de3bdb54a47c0cca1f263 OP_EQUAL
address
3C2EUtbnkiLfYu315zyV1SMDYJfNkMhvJN
transaction
d80b745b8d1b9e8cc7d24a35981b99315b823628974ed94caec85d394231aca5
confirmations
115369
spent
true